About this cottage rental

Camisky Steading in Torlundy near Fort William sleeps six guests.

Camisky Steading, a three-bedroom property, features two super-king-size zip/link beds that can be converted into twins on request and one twin zip/link bed that can be made into a super-king-size. It includes a bathroom with a bath and basin, a shower room with a walk-in shower, basin, and WC, and a cloakroom with a basin and WC. The home offers a kitchen/diner, a utility, and a first-floor sitting room with a woodburning stove. Amenities include a gas hob, an electric oven, a dishwasher, a fridge/freezer, a microwave, a washing machine, a TV with FreeSat, and WiFi. High chair and travel cot are available upon request. WiFi, fuel, power, bed linen, and towels, are included in the rent. There is ample off-road parking. Two well-behaved dogs are welcome, but smoking is not permitted. Shop 4 miles, pub 5.2 miles, river 0.1 miles. Escape to the beautiful Highlands of Scotland with a stay at Camisky Steading. Town: The main town in the Western Highlands, Fort William lies on the banks of Loch Linnhe, and offers a wide variety of shops, and pubs which serve a fine selection of meals. The area boasts spectacular scenery and a plethora of walking opportunities, from gentle ambles to more strenuous expeditions, and of course, Britain’s highest mountain, Ben Nevis. Ski enthusiasts will also enjoy the Nevis Range, a ski resort with a mountain gondola, along with a World Cup mountain biking course located just four miles from Fort William. For a more relaxing break, why not take a tour of the Ben Nevis Whisky Distillery, or visit the Glenfinnan Monument? An ideal location for exploring the best of the breathtaking West Highlands.
